How much do cold calling j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 5, 2026, the average hourly pay for cold calling in Georgia is $15.56,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$12.16 and $17.88 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a cold calling specialist,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Cold Calling Specialist, you need excellent verbal communication, persuasive sales techniques, and a basic understanding of the products or services being offered, often supported by prior sales experience or training. Familiarity with customer relationship management (CRM) software and auto-dialing systems is typically required. Persistence, resilience, and active listening are crucial soft skills that help build rapport and handle rejection effectively. These abilities are essential for consistently generating leads, meeting sales targets, and fostering positive customer interactions in a competitive environment.

What are some common challenges faced in a cold calling role, and how can they be overcome?

One of the main challenges in a cold calling role is handling frequent rejection and maintaining motivation throughout the day. Additionally, it can be difficult to quickly build rapport with prospects and capture their interest within the first few seconds of a call. To overcome these challenges, it's helpful to develop strong communication skills, use a well-crafted script, and stay persistent while adapting your approach based on feedback. Regular team meetings and support from colleagues can also provide valuable encouragement and help you refine your technique.

What is cold calling?

Cold calling is the practice of contacting potential customers or clients who have not previously expressed interest in the products or services being offered. It typically involves making unsolicited phone calls with the aim of generating sales leads, appointments, or direct sales. Cold calling is a common sales technique used across various industries, and it requires strong communication skills, persistence, and the ability to handle rejection. Successful cold callers research their prospects beforehand and use tailored scripts to increase their chances of a positive response.

What is the difference between Cold Calling vs Telemarketing?

AspectCold CallingTelemarketing
CredentialsNone specific, sales skills preferredNone specific, sales skills preferred
Work EnvironmentOne-on-one calls, often solo or small teamsCan be solo or team-based, often in call centers
Industry UsageCommon in sales, B2B, B2CCommon in sales, fundraising, market research

While both Cold Calling and Telemarketing involve making outbound calls to potential clients or customers, Cold Calling typically refers to individual, direct calls to prospects without prior contact. Telemarketing often involves larger-scale campaigns, sometimes with scripts, and may include both outbound and inbound calls. Both roles require strong communication skills and sales knowledge, but Cold Calling is more focused on personalized outreach, whereas Telemarketing may involve broader marketing efforts.

What is cold calling?

Cold calling is a telemarketing practice that works to gather qualified leads. You use the phone to call a potential customer to see if they are a viable prospect for a product or service. This task is an important step in the sales process since it narrows down the people who are most likely going to want to try the service or a product. Once you vet the lead, you typically pass it to a sales representative to close. Using cold calling helps companies save time and money while still finding new clients or customers.
